
Amy Grant’s 1988 album LEAD ME ON, ranked the #1 modern Christian record of all time
by CCM Magazine, will be reissued in an expanded two-disc twentieth anniversary edition through Sparrow Records on June 24. A
20-city tour (recreating the original Lead Me On Tour) is planned for October.
LEAD ME ON, featuring the title track, “1974,” “Saved by Love,” and “If These Walls Could Speak,” will contain a bonus disc including interviews with Amy Grant and Michael W. Smith, four unreleased live cuts from the Lead Me On Tour (“Wait for the Healing,” “Shadows,” “All Right,” “Lead Me On”), and new acoustic versions of “Faithless Heart,” “Say Once More,” and “Lead Me On.”
